  1. Self-Care during the Job Search:

The job search process can be demanding, emotionally draining, and time-consuming. It is crucial for job seekers to prioritize self-care to maintain their physical and mental well-being. This includes getting sufficient rest, eating nutritious meals, exercising regularly, and engaging in activities that promote relaxation and stress relief. Taking care of oneself ensures that job seekers have the energy and resilience to navigate the challenges of the job search process.

  1. Seeking Support and Mentorship:

Job seekers should actively seek support and mentorship from experienced professionals in the healthcare industry. Engaging with mentors can provide valuable guidance, industry insights, and networking opportunities. Joining professional associations, attending career fairs, and participating in networking events are effective ways to connect with experienced professionals who can offer advice and support during the job search.

  1. Developing a Personal Brand:

In a competitive job market, it is essential for job seekers to develop a strong personal brand. This involves identifying their unique strengths, skills, and experiences that set them apart from other candidates. Building a professional online presence through platforms like LinkedIn can showcase their expertise and make them more visible to potential employers. Crafting a compelling resume and cover letter that highlight relevant accomplishments and skills is also crucial in capturing the attention of hiring managers.

  1. Continuous Learning and Skill Development:

The healthcare industry is constantly evolving, with new technologies, treatment modalities, and research advancements emerging regularly. Job seekers should embrace a mindset of continuous learning and skill development. Staying updated with industry trends, participating in relevant workshops or webinars, and pursuing certifications can enhance their marketability and demonstrate their commitment to professional growth.

  1. Managing Stress and Rejection:

The job search process can be emotionally challenging, and job seekers may face rejection or setbacks along the way. It is important to develop effective stress management techniques and resilience strategies to cope with these experiences. Seeking emotional support from friends, family, or professional counselors can help job seekers navigate the emotional rollercoaster of job hunting and maintain a positive mindset.

  1. Cultivating a Growth Mindset:

Job seekers should approach their search for employment with a growth mindset. Embracing challenges, viewing setbacks as learning opportunities, and maintaining a positive attitude can make a significant difference in the job search journey. Remaining persistent, adaptable, and open to new possibilities can lead to unexpected opportunities and long-term career success.
